Indiana Reinstates Time Limits for Some Food Stamp Recipients

INDIANAPOLIS (WOWO): Starting next spring, Indiana will start limiting food stamp benefits to thousands of healthy adults without children who fail to get a job or train for work at least 20 hours a week. Those that fall into that category will be limited to no more than three months of benefits during a three-year period. With the new requirement, an estimated 65,000 of the 877,000 Hoosiers receiving food stamps will be impacted.
